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 lb boneless skinless chicken breasts
  • 1½ tsp Kosher salt
  • 1 tsp dried oregano
  • ¼ tsp freshly ground black pepper
  • 2 Tbsp extra virgin olive oil
  • 2 Tbsp unsalted butter
  • 1 medium sweet onion, diced
  • 2 sticks celery, finely chopped
  • ½ cup sun-dried tomatoes, finely chopped
  • 4 cloves garlic, finely chopped
  • 2 Tbsp tomato paste
  • 4 cups low-sodium chicken broth
  • 2 Tbsp pesto, store-bought or homemade
  • 16 oz dried potato gnocchi
  • ½1 cup heavy cream, adjust to preference
  • 5 oz fresh baby spinach
  • ½ cup Parmesan, grated

Instructions

  1. Season cubed chicken with salt, oregano, and pepper in a bowl.
  2. Heat olive oil and butter in a pot over medium-high heat. Brown the chicken for about 4-5 minutes; transfer to a plate.
  3. In the same pot, sauté diced onion and celery with salt until translucent (3-5 minutes). Add sun-dried tomatoes, garlic, and tomato paste; stir well.
  4. Pour in chicken broth and add pesto; bring to a boil, then reduce heat to simmer for 10-15 minutes.
  5. Return chicken to the pot and stir in gnocchi; cook until they float (about 3-5 minutes).
  6. Stir in cream, spinach, and Parmesan cheese. Adjust seasoning as needed before serving.
